Big news for Torchwood fans: the British sci-fi series is heading to a new network for its next season.

EW’s Michael Ausiello reports that premium cable network Starz has just acquired the U.S. rights to the show. Premiering in summer 2011, the cult-hit series will be broadcast simultaneously on Starz here in U.S., and BBC One in the U.K.

What would happen if you could travel through time, not by physically entering a a time machine, but actually swapping lives with people in the past? Now suppose that some mysterious force decided to use you to fix things during those visits, “set right what once went wrong” and change lives for the better through your travels? This is the concept that launched yet another highly successful series for Donald P. Bellisario (Magnum, P.I., Airwolf, Battlestar Gallactica, JAG) and launched a career for series star Scott Bakula.

Every story has a beginning, however, and it’s only fitting that we start there. Careful viewers (and overly analytical fanatics like myself) will also note that there are many clues in this pilot episode that not only set the tone for the entire series, but also give us glimpses into some of the mysteries that arise in the 5 years to follow.

This is the eighth episode of the first season and the first really major plot point in the overall story arc. We get the answer to one major question but of course the answer just leads us to more questions. Commander Jeffery Sinclair was at the Battle of the Line and disappeared for 24 hours just before the Minbari surrendered.

He has always claimed that he blacked out during this time and had no memory of what had happened. For some on Earth, there has been a cloud of suspicion hanging over Sinclair’s head.
